#a1948d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a1948d is composed of 63.1% red, 58%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.1% magenta, 12.4%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 21 degrees, a saturation of 9.6% and a lightness of 59.2%. #a1948d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#43291b.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

● #a1948d color description : Dark grayish orange.
#a1948d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a1948d has RGB values of R:161, G:148,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.08, Y:0.12,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10589325.
